CITY OF COURTENAY
REQUIREMENTS FOR PERMIT APPLICATION FOR STANDARD BUILDINGS
PROVIDE 2 SETS OF DRAWINGS OF SUITABLE SCALE as well as:
a site plan, or at the discretion of the Building Official, a site plan prepared by a British Columbia Land Surveyor showing:
the bearing and dimensions of the parcel taken from the registered subdivision plan
the legal description and civic address of the parcel
the location and dimensions of all statutory rights of way, easements and setbacks requirements
the location and dimensions of all existing and proposed buildings or structures on the parcel
setbacks to the natural boundary of any lake, swamp, pond or watercourse where the City of Courtenay’s land use regulations establish siting requirements related to flooding
the existing and finished ground levels to an established datum at or adjacent to the site and the geodetic elevation of the underside of the floor system of a building or structure where the City of Courtenay’s land use regulations establish siting requirements related to minimum floor elevations
the location, dimension and gradient of parking and driveway access
(the Building Official may waive the requirements for a site plan, in whole or in part, where the permit is sought for the repair or alteration of an existing building or structure)
- a foundation plan showing all required bearing locations of the structure being transferred to the foundation
floor plans showing the dimensions and uses of all areas: the dimensions and height of crawl and roof spaces; the location, size and swing of doors; the location, size and opening of windows; floor, wall, and ceiling finishes; plumbing fixtures; structural elements; and stair dimensions
a cross section through the building or structure illustrating foundations, drainage, ceiling heights and construction systems
elevations of all sides of the building or structure showing finish details, roof slopes, windows, doors and finished grade
cross-sectional details drawn at an appropriate scale and at sufficient locations to illustrate that the building or structure substantially conforms to the Building Code
Mobile Home
Application for a permit to locate a mobile home need not be accompanied by any structural details of the mobile home itself, but it must include a plot plan and CSA Certification Number.
